Leadership Review Briefing — Supplier Contract Renewal

For the incoming director: our agreement with Varnholt Components, which supplies casings for the Brellix line, expires at quarter-end. Pricing has held steady, but delivery reliability slipped to 91% after their Oskarvik plant retooled. Procurement recommends a two-year renewal with revised penalty clauses rather than switching to an untested vendor. Before the review, please note the confidential strategic context below.

management briefing: Project Ulavan slips by two quarters because of the staffing delay.

Subject: On-call handover — orders soft deletes

Hi Marek,

Quick note before you take over. We shipped the soft-delete change to the Cartwheel orders table last night: rows now get a deleted_at timestamp instead of being removed. Plugin authors querying orders directly must filter on deleted_at IS NULL, or they'll see ghost orders. The compat view orders_active handles this automatically. Docs are updated in the Cartwheel developer portal. If plugin authors hit anything weird, route them to the integrations inbox.

escalation mailbox, tafop-fahif: oliael@tolvaqlabs.corp

**Key Ceremony Checklist — Item 7 (Quillstone Renderer):** Confirm the markdown rendering pipeline's signing key was rotated before sealing. Verify the sanitizer allowlist hash matches the printed manifest, that both witnesses initialed the build attestation, and that the old key shards were destroyed on camera. Once all boxes are ticked, the ceremony custodian re-seals the escrow envelope using the recovery passphrase below.

vault phrase of bagaf-kajeg = jorath-feniel-briir-siliel-ralix

Subject: Handover — Shoreline tide-table widget release

Hi,

Handing over the Shoreline widget v2.1 deploy. The tide-table data feed from the Corvane station is stable, and the rollout is paused at 40% pending your sign-off. Canary metrics look clean. If you need to resume or roll back tonight, the deploy key for the pipeline is:

release key, fahaf-bajof: bky3_Xam